Understanding Your Metabolism After Weight Loss
When you lose weight, especially through a period of caloric restriction, your body adapts to the lower energy intake in various ways. Your total daily energy expenditure (TDEE) decreases because a smaller body requires less energy to function. Your body also undergoes a process called metabolic adaptation, where your metabolism slows down to conserve energy, a primal survival mechanism. This is why many people hit weight loss plateaus or regain weight quickly when they return to their old eating habits. Your resting metabolic rate (RMR), the calories your body burns at rest, is lower than it was before you lost weight. Hormonal changes also play a significant role, with hunger-regulating hormones like leptin (which signals fullness) and ghrelin (which increases hunger) shifting to increase your appetite. Recognizing these changes is the first step toward a successful transition.
The Principle of Reverse Dieting
Reverse dieting is a strategic approach to incrementally increasing calorie intake after a period of weight loss. Instead of jumping immediately back to your pre-diet calorie levels, which can shock your system and lead to rapid fat gain, you add a small amount of calories each week or every two weeks. This slow and controlled process allows your metabolism to adjust gradually, helping to restore hormonal balance and increase your energy expenditure over time. By tracking your progress, you can find your new maintenance calorie level and potentially eat more food while staying lean.
Step-by-Step Guide to a Reverse Diet
- Calculate Your New Maintenance Calories: Your maintenance level is likely lower now than it was before you started dieting. Use an online TDEE calculator based on your new weight and activity level to get an estimate. A simpler method is to track your intake over the final few weeks of your weight loss phase and use your rate of loss to determine your current maintenance.
- Plan Your Incremental Increase: A common starting point is to increase your daily intake by 50–100 calories per week or every other week. This increase should primarily come from carbohydrates and fats, as your protein intake should already be consistently high.
- Track and Monitor: Use a food tracking app or a journal to log your intake and monitor your weight. Be aware that you may see a small, initial weight increase from extra food volume and water retention (due to increased carbs), but this is not fat gain and should stabilize. If your weight remains stable, you can continue with the next incremental increase.
- Repeat and Adjust: Continue this process for 4–10 weeks, or until you reach your new maintenance calorie target. Pay close attention to how your body responds in terms of weight, energy levels, and hunger. Adjust the calorie increments and pace as needed.
The Role of Macronutrients in Calorie Increase
When increasing calories, the quality of your food is just as important as the quantity. A focus on balanced macronutrients is crucial for restoring metabolic health and supporting your body's new needs.
Macronutrient Recommendations
| Macronutrient | Role in Calorie Increase | Examples of Healthy Sources |
|---|---|---|
| Protein | Essential for preserving and building muscle mass. Helps with satiety, which can prevent overeating. | Lean meats, fish, eggs, legumes, Greek yogurt, tofu |
| Carbohydrates | Your body's primary energy source. Crucial for fueling workouts and restoring muscle glycogen stores. | Oats, quinoa, brown rice, sweet potatoes, fruits |
| Fats | Energy-dense, providing 9 calories per gram. Essential for hormone production and nutrient absorption. | Avocados, nuts, seeds, olive oil, fatty fish |
Strategic Meal Timing and High-Calorie Foods
To consume more calories without feeling overly stuffed, consider making some strategic changes to your diet. Instead of just adding extra volume, focus on calorie-dense, nutrient-rich foods that pack a punch without adding excessive bulk. Adding extra snacks between meals can also help you distribute your intake more comfortably throughout the day.
- Snack ideas: Mix nuts, seeds, and dried fruit for a high-energy trail mix.
- Smoothies: Blend whole milk or full-fat yogurt with nut butter, oats, and fruit for a calorie-dense drink.
- Cooking additions: Drizzle extra virgin olive oil over salads or cooked vegetables. Add cheese or avocado to your meals.
- Meal timing: Consider a larger, protein-rich breakfast to boost metabolism and control appetite throughout the day, as research suggests eating more calories earlier can be beneficial.
The Importance of Exercise and Strength Training
Integrating or increasing your exercise routine, particularly strength training, is a vital component of increasing calories after weight loss. Building muscle mass increases your RMR, meaning you burn more calories at rest, making it easier to eat more without gaining fat. Aim to incorporate strength training sessions 2–3 times per week, focusing on compound movements like squats, deadlifts, and bench presses. Complement this with regular physical activity, including cardio, to further support metabolic function and overall health.
Psychological Aspects: Patience and Mindful Eating
For many, the transition out of a restrictive diet can be mentally challenging. The meticulous tracking of a reverse diet can be stressful for some, and it’s important to prioritize your mental well-being. Practicing mindful eating, paying attention to your body’s hunger and fullness cues, can help you develop a healthier relationship with food. Instead of obsessing over every calorie, focus on making sustainable, healthy choices that leave you feeling satisfied and energized. Remember, restoring your metabolism and maintaining your weight is a marathon, not a sprint. Consistency and patience are key.
